Due to … WebJan 31, 2013 · Table 14.6.3.4 is an addition to the new standard and is used to refer to acceptance grades and tolerance bands. Six pump performance test acceptance grades are used: 1B, 1E, 1U, 2B, 2U and 3B. Grade 1 is the most stringent, and the “U” specifies having a unilateral tolerance band. The “B” specifies having a bilateral tolerance band.

WebApr 12, 2024 · 7.7: Standard States of Pure Substances. It is often useful to refer to a reference pressure, the standard pressure, denoted p\st. The standard pressure has an arbitrary but constant value in any given application. Until 1982, chemists used a standard pressure of 1\unitsatm ( 1.01325\timesten5\Pa ).
